You could try adding sudo in your cron script, but then you have to
configure nmcli to be sudoed without password. You will probably want to
have a look at /etc/dbus-1/system.d/NetworkManager.conf. This specifies
what is allowed and there is a special policy configuration with
attribute
Unfortunately, there was no nmcli on 10.04, so there is no way to
compare how it worked.
